Key Insights of Japan Sport Footwear Market

  • Market Size (2023): Estimated at approximately USD 3.2 billion, reflecting steady growth driven by health consciousness and sports participation.
  • Forecast Value (2023–2030): Projected to reach USD 4.8 billion, with a CAGR of around 6.2%, fueled by innovation and demographic shifts.
  • Leading Segment: Athletic running shoes dominate, accounting for over 45% of total sales, followed by training and casual sports footwear.
  • Core Application: Primarily driven by fitness activities, competitive sports, and lifestyle branding, with a rising trend in athleisure wear integration.
  • Dominant Geography: Greater Tokyo and Kansai regions hold the largest market shares, benefiting from urbanization and affluent consumer bases.
  • Market Opportunity: Growing demand for sustainable and technologically advanced footwear presents significant expansion avenues.
  • Major Players: Nike Japan, Adidas Japan, Asics, Puma Japan, and local brands like Mizuno are key industry leaders shaping the competitive landscape.

Market Dynamics in Japan’s Sport Footwear Sector

The Japan sport footwear industry is characterized by a mature yet innovation-driven landscape. Consumer preferences are increasingly shifting toward high-performance, eco-friendly, and digitally integrated products. The market’s maturity is evidenced by widespread brand loyalty, premium pricing strategies, and a focus on technological differentiation. Key drivers include rising health awareness, government initiatives promoting active lifestyles, and the proliferation of fitness culture across urban centers.

However, the industry faces challenges such as demographic aging, which impacts youth-oriented marketing, and supply chain disruptions caused by global geopolitical tensions. The competitive environment is intense, with multinational corporations leveraging advanced R&D and localized marketing to maintain dominance. Additionally, the surge in e-commerce channels has transformed distribution strategies, enabling brands to reach niche segments more effectively. Overall, Japan’s sport footwear market is poised for sustainable growth, driven by innovation and evolving consumer expectations.

Strategic Positioning and Competitive Landscape in Japan Sport Footwear Market

Major brands in Japan are adopting a multi-channel approach, integrating brick-and-mortar retail with digital platforms to enhance consumer engagement. Nike and Adidas focus on premium segments, emphasizing innovation and brand collaborations, while local brands like Mizuno capitalize on heritage and specialized sports niches. The competitive rivalry is intensified by the emergence of direct-to-consumer models, which allow for better margin control and customer data acquisition.

Strategic alliances with sports teams, athletes, and fitness influencers are commonplace, boosting brand visibility and credibility. Sustainability initiatives, such as biodegradable materials and carbon-neutral manufacturing, are increasingly influencing consumer choices. Market players are also investing heavily in R&D to develop lightweight, durable, and technologically advanced footwear tailored for Japan’s diverse climatic and sporting conditions. This strategic positioning fosters brand loyalty and sustains competitive advantage in a saturated market.

Dynamic Market Forces Shaping Japan’s Sport Footwear Industry

Porter’s Five Forces analysis reveals a highly competitive landscape with significant supplier power due to specialized materials and manufacturing processes. Buyer power is elevated by the availability of numerous brands and online channels, enabling consumers to compare and switch easily. Threats from new entrants are moderate, given high brand loyalty and capital requirements, but niche startups focusing on sustainability and innovation are emerging rapidly.

Substitutes such as casual sneakers and lifestyle footwear are gaining popularity, impacting traditional sports segment growth. The bargaining power of retailers influences pricing strategies, especially in premium segments. Overall, the industry’s profitability hinges on innovation, brand differentiation, and supply chain resilience, with strategic alliances and technological advancements serving as key competitive levers.
